Technological Synchronization and Efficient POS Systems:
To streamline operations and improve efficiency, I invested in synchronizing my POS systems across multiple locations. This technological integration allowed for seamless communication and coordination between different areas of my business. By investing approximately $5000.00 in this setup, I was able to eliminate inefficiencies and reduce errors in order processing, leading to smoother operations and enhanced customer satisfaction.
Pricing Strategy and Menu Optimization:
Implementing the "holy formula" for pricing, I carefully analysed my menu and adjusted prices accordingly. This formula considers ingredient costs, preparation time, and perceived value, allowing for a fair and profitable pricing structure. Additionally, I ensured that I had the right products in stock, eliminating unnecessary inventory expenses and wastage. By optimizing the menu and pricing strategy, I maximized profitability and increased the value perception for customers.
